For the purpose of the present research, regarded benefits and obstacles to psychological health and wellness help-seeking are being discovered. Previous research study found that regarded barriers have a considerable effect on university student' health and wellness actions options (Von Ah, Ebert, Ngamvitroj, Park & Kang, 2003). Perceived benefits and obstacles to help-seeking were particularly selected because of their influence on decision-making and eventually activity (Glanz, Rimer, & Su, 2005).


Today study seeks to analyze whether stigma acts as an obstacle to therapy among university students. Eisenberg et al. (2011) proposed that hesitation about treatment efficiency is one more obstacle to getting involved in treatment. Research study findings exposed that university student endorsed several obstacles to participating in therapy. Mental Health Counseling. Amongst these were: (1) liking to handle mental health issue themselves, (2) not having adequate time to take part in treatment, (3) concerns regarding whether psychological health and wellness treatment is reliable in remediating troubles, (4) an idea that tension is normal or the issue will improve without therapy, (5) lack of cash, and (6) stress over what others would certainly believe if they learnt about therapy involvement.


(2006) reported similar variables find out this here as barriers to seeking treatment and likewise located that a mistrust of companies may restrain students from looking for help. Personnel in university mental health and wellness centers may be perceived as unfriendly, and long wait times for solutions may be "off-putting" for students. Aspects helping with more positive attitudes are frequently at the contrary pole of those variables recognized as obstacles.

Results suggested no substantial distinction in viewed advantages based on ever seeing a psychological health counselor. Results indicated that the leading 3 perceived barriers were humiliation, rejection, and not wishing to be labeled insane (Table 3). The lowest regarded obstacles were absence of insurance coverage, not desiring aid, and not desiring to be positioned on medication.

Univariate F-tests identified particular subscale products that substantially varied. Females were less likely than men to perceive people who try this web-site most likely to counseling as emotionally weak, people who go to therapy as insane, to feel that individuals with psychological health troubles must handle troubles on their very own, that people who most likely to counseling as unable to fix troubles, that people who most likely to therapy slouch, and to feel that individuals who most likely to counseling are various from regular people in an adverse method.




Research results revealed that women were substantially less likely than men to hold stigma-related perspectives. This is regular with previous research which likewise located that males hold greater degrees of regarded stigma than ladies (Chandra & Minkovitz, 2006).
